Travel Compression Socks for Long Flights
Travel compression socks are designed to apply gentle pressure to your legs and feet, helping to improve blood circulation, especially during long periods of sitting, like on a flight. These socks are typically tight at the ankle and gradually become looser towards the knee. This pressure helps your veins function better, reducing the risk of swelling and discomfort during long flights.
Long flights can bring unwanted issues like swollen legs and feet. If you have ever experienced discomfort during a flight, you are not alone. Travel compression socks can help alleviate these problems by improving circulation, reducing swelling, and keeping your legs comfortable throughout the journey.

Why Should You Wear Compression Socks on a Flight
Reduce Swelling: When you sit for a long time on a plane, the blood in your legs can pool, causing swelling, especially in the feet and ankles. Compression socks help push the blood back toward the heart, reducing swelling and keeping your legs feeling light and comfortable.
Prevent Deep Vein Thrombosis: is a condition where blood clots form in the veins, often in the legs. Long flights are a risk factor for DVT because of the extended sitting period. Wearing long flight socks can reduce the risk of clots by encouraging better circulation.
Improve Comfort: Sitting in one position for hours can make your legs feel stiff and tired. Travel compression socks provide support and prevent the heaviness that comes from sitting for too long.
How to Choose the Right Compression Socks for Flights
It is best to wear compression socks for flights from the moment you board the plane until you land. They should be worn throughout the flight, but you can remove them when you are not seated. If you are sensitive to swelling or have circulatory issues, it is a good idea to wear them even before the flight and for a while after you arrive.
Graduated Compression: Make sure the socks offer graduated compression, which is the most effective for promoting blood flow.
Proper Fit: Ensure that the socks fit snugly but aren’t too tight. Compression socks should apply pressure without causing discomfort.
Material: Look for breathable, moisture-wicking materials to keep your feet comfortable and dry during the flight.
